Click to Find: Contact Details | Driving Directions | Nearby Solar Panel Dealers
Find Holly Solar Products Location, Phone Number, Business Hours, and Service Offerings.
Get directions to Holly Solar Products and view location on map.
Enphase Energy 201 1st St Ste 300 Petaluma, 94952
SunMizer Solar Roofing System 1360 Redwood Way Ste A Petaluma, 94954
Back To Solar 111 Goodwin Ave Penngrove, 94951
JBL Solar Energy Cleaning, Solar Panel Contracting, Solar Panel Repair, Solar Panels 7911 Redwood Dr Ste 201 Cotati, 94931
Unisun Solar Heating Contracting, Solar Panel Repair, Solar Panels 8278 Old Redwood Hwy Cotati, 94931
Excel Solar & Electric Electrical Services, Solar Panels PO Box 1826 Glen Ellen, 95442
Empower Energy Solutions Heating Contracting, Solar Panels 205 5th St Santa Rosa, 95401
Solar Universe 3345 Industrial Dr Ste 10 Santa Rosa, 95403